"Etretat, the Needle Rock and Porte d'Aval" is a pastel painting by Claude Monet, completed in 1885. It depicts the iconic rock formations of Etretat, France, a favorite subject for Monet and other Impressionist artists. The soft pastel strokes capture the subtle nuances of light and color in the cloudy sky, the calm sea, and the dramatic cliffs. The scene is composed with a strong vertical emphasis, drawing the viewer's eye upwards to the sky. This work showcases Monet's mastery of color and his ability to capture the ephemeral nature of light and atmosphere.
